Correct Answer: (3)
Solution : The error lies in the third part of the sentence.
In the third part, "to picnic" should be replaced with "to the picnic". The picnic refers to a specific occasion; and hence, the article "the" should precede the word picnic.
Therefore, the correct sentence is: Unless Geeta apologises, she should not be allowed to go to the picnic.
